Expert Insights on Vacuum Brazed Cold Plates
Experts in thermal management have voiced their opinions on the potential limitations of vacuum brazed cold plates. According to Dr. Lisa Chen, a thermal efficiency researcher, "While vacuum brazed cold plates offer superior thermal conductivity, the quality of the manufacturing process is crucial. Any misalignment or contamination during the brazing can lead to performance issues." This highlights the need for precision in the production of these components.
The Importance of Quality Control
Quality control is paramount, as mentioned by John Mitchell, a director of engineering at a leading cooling solutions firm. He states, "We've seen how even minor defects in vacuum brazed cold plates can cause significant reliability issues. Implementing stringent testing and quality assurance processes is vital for optimizing their performance." This perspective reinforces the idea that the manufacturing process cannot be taken lightly.

Challenges and Considerations
Despite their advantages, vacuum brazed cold plates face challenges that cannot be ignored. Mike Thompson, a product development manager, notes that "Environmental factors can influence the performance and reliability of these cold plates. Extreme temperatures, for example, can degrade the material properties, which makes it important to select the right materials for specific environments." Understanding these external influences can be crucial for extending the lifespan of cooling solutions.
